Hart won the last time they faced Canyon and things went their way on Wednesday too. The Hart Hawks escaped with a win against the Canyon Cowboys by the margin of a single free throw, 41-40. The win was nothing new for the Hawks as they're now sitting on five straight.
Hart got their victory on the backs of several key players, but it was Morgan Mack out in front who almost dropped a double-double with 14 points and nine boards. The team also got some help courtesy of Emery Eav, who posted seven points in addition to seven rebounds and three steals.
Hart smashed the offensive glass and finished the game with 18 offensive boards. That strong performance was nothing new for the team: they've now pulled down at least nine offensive rebounds in 12 consecutive contests.
Despite the loss, Canyon still got an impressive performance from Lanie Rafkind, who went 6 of 9 from beyond the arc to rack up 22 points and five boards. The dominant performance gave Rafkind a new career-high in points. Another player making a difference was Brooke Phillips, who put up three points and five rebounds.
Hart's win bumped their record up to 20-7. As for Canyon, their loss dropped their record down to 14-14.
